List, A while back, I posted about Kawai sticking styrene flanges. Few people really knew the answer since these flanges rarely stick. Fortunately, Don Mannino came to my rescue. The correct repair is a set of *straight* reamers that Don designed, which are available from Schaff for about $12.00. Dons method gets high reviews and scores from me. The tools are inexpensive, give very predictable results and it's virtually impossible to over ream since the reamers are parallel instead of tapered and each is a different size.
